Lip oil is a skin care product that can be applied directly on the lips. It is slightly more moisturizing than cosmetics, but more oily than lip gloss. It is very suitable for moisturizing those who are born with chapped lips. During the development process of lip oil, glycerin, surfactants, and aromatherapy are added to it to make the lips full of moisture and look very moisturized.

Apply directly to lips

Generally speaking, the order of lip makeup should be: lip liner to lipstick to lip gloss to lip gloss and finally lip oil. Of course, a lot of the steps in between can be omitted according to personal requirements.

Lip oil - a little more oily than lip gloss, and more moisturizing to lips. It is suitable for people with particularly dry and chapped lips. For most people, it will be too oily and uncomfortable, and easily "eat away makeup".

Lip gloss is a mixture of multiple substances, and different brands of lip gloss have different formulas. They generally include some silicone oil, liquid paraffin, glycerin, surfactants, flavors and the like.

Let your lips drink enough water

1. After washing your face, apply a thick layer of lip cream to protect your lips, but be sure to read the ingredients of the lip oil carefully. It must not contain phenol or carbolic acid, otherwise it will be counterproductive.

2. Use a wet towel or a very soft toothbrush to slowly remove dead skin, and apply a deeply moisturizing Vaseline or olive oil to improve dryness and peeling of the lip skin.

3. Use moisturizing lipstick made from antioxidant ingredients such as vitamin E and natural ingredients with moisturizing and anti-inflammatory functions such as aloe vera and mint to better retain moisture on the lips and moisturize the lip skin.
